Helicopter deal could create 600 new jobs

Summary

The UK government awarded a £1 billion contract to Leonardo Helicopters for building 23 new military helicopters. This deal will create around 600 new jobs at the Yeovil site and sustain a total of 3,300 jobs directly involved with this project. The agreement secures the future of the site and may lead to significant export opportunities.

Key Facts

  • Leonardo Helicopters received a £1 billion contract from the UK Ministry of Defence.
  • They will build 23 new medium helicopters at their Yeovil site in Somerset.
  • The deal is expected to create 600 new jobs.
  • It will also sustain 3,300 existing jobs.
  • Future export orders could bring in over £15 billion over the next 10 years.
  • The contract secures the site's future and increases job count by 20%.
  • Leonardo initially bid to build 44 helicopters, but the contract was reduced due to budget cuts.
  • Leonardo has several other locations in the UK, including sites in Edinburgh and Luton.
